LCD Soundsystem North American Tour

artist: lcd soundsystem date: 08/17/2007 category: press releases

Following a series of international dates, LCD Soundsystem will return to the U.S. for a fall tour with Arcade Fire that launches on September 17th at Denver's Red Rocks Amphitheatre. The two bands are also pairing up to produce a limited edition split 7" single featuring LCD Soundsystem's cover of Joy Division's "No Love Lost" and Arcade Fire's cover of Serge Gainsbourg's "Poupee de Cire". The single will be available exclusively on the tour dates and through the bands' websites.

LCD Soundsystem will perform on "The Tonight Show with Jay Leno" on September 19th, the day after the release of the new digital EP A Bunch of Stuff on DFA Records/Capitol Music Group. The EP will include Franz Ferdinand's cover of LCD Soundsystem's current single, "All My Friends," plus remixes of other songs from Sound of Silver by Soul Wax ("Get Innocuous"), Carl Craig ("Sound of Silver"), Sorcerer ("Us v Them") and Gucci Sound System ("Time to Get Away") and LCD Soundsystem performing "Us v Them" live on KCRW's "Morning Becomes Eclectic."

Artist Doug Aitken is currently shooting an experimental short film for the upcoming UK single "someone great." Doug Aitken's work has been exhibited extensively at museums and festivals throughout Europe and the U.S. His most recent work, "Sleepwalkers," was commissioned by MoMA. Also coming this fall from the LCD Soundsystem camp: the re-release of 45:33 with three UK b-sides previously unreleased in the States (November 12th on DFA Records) and Fabriclive36: James Murphy & Pat Mahoney, a mix album from LCD Soundsystem founder Murphy and percussionist Pat Mahoney (November 20th via Caroline).

With Sound of Silver, the follow-up to its Grammy-nominated, self-titled 2005 debut, LCD Soundsystem further expanded its sonic palette, taking its experimental impulses to wild new places, but also firmly establishing itself as a singularly great pop group. Sound of Silver earned four-star reviews from Rolling Stone, Spin and the Los Angeles Times. The New York Times pronounced it "The strongest stuff of Mr. Murphy's career" while The New Yorker called it "magnificent." And the band's live shows continue to elicit resoundingly stellar reviews as well: "LCD mastermind James Murphy and his band rev up the beats per minute to new extremes, and it's thrilling," said the Chicago Tribune of the band's recent knock-out performance at Lollapalooza. "When the band launches into the rising tide of 'All My Friends,' it completely owns Grant Park." Their performance the following day at Washington, DC's V Festival was equally mesmerizing: "Importing ragged post-punk and no-wave elements into accessible dance-punk, the James Murphy gang turned out one of the best sets of Day One," said harpmagazine.com. "The breakneck disco beats and Gang of Four bass lines never let up, and Murphy's groggy croon was too cool. In their recording career, LCD is batting one thousand, so the set list couldn't make a wrong turn: 'North American Scum' and 'Daft Punk is Playing at My House' sounded especially saucy."
